What people use each for

The jobs each tool is most often brought in to do.

Nebula

  • Flattening a network across several clouds and datacentres without VPC peering or route tablesnot Trivy
  • Very large fleets where a central policy service on the connection path is unacceptablenot Trivy
  • Environments that already run an internal certificate authority and want the network to use itnot Trivy
  • Replacing per host iptables rules with policy written against roles that follow the hostnot Trivy

Trivy

  • Failing a pull request when a container image introduces a known CVEnot Nebula
  • Scanning Terraform and Kubernetes manifests for misconfiguration before applynot Nebula
  • Catching committed secrets as part of an existing CI stepnot Nebula

Where each one falls short

Documented limitations, not opinions. Every one is a constraint you would hit in normal use.

Nebula

  • The open source project has no user interface, no enrolment workflow and no revocation service, so certificate issuing, distribution and expiry become scripts you write and then have to keep working.
  • Revoking a compromised host means distributing a blocklist entry to every other host and reloading them, which is a fleet wide operation rather than a click, and easy to get wrong under pressure.
  • Changing a host group membership means reissuing and redeploying its certificate, so policy changes are a deployment rather than a configuration edit.
  • There is no identity provider integration or single sign on in the open source version, so it maps well to servers and badly to a fleet of user laptops.
  • NAT traversal is best effort and hosts behind symmetric NAT need a relay configured deliberately, so connectivity failures show up as intermittent rather than immediate and are awkward to diagnose.

Trivy

  • Reports what public advisory databases know, so coverage varies by ecosystem and unfixed CVEs create noise
  • No built-in triage or exception workflow, so suppressing accepted risk is managed in config files
  • Findings are point-in-time from CI, with no continuous runtime monitoring unless you add the commercial platform

Answered from the vendors’ own pages

Nebula: Does it use WireGuard?

No. Nebula predates the common WireGuard mesh tools and uses the Noise protocol framework with its own certificate format.

Trivy: Is Trivy free?

Yes, open source from Aqua Security with no licence fee. Aqua sells a commercial platform around it.

Nebula: Can I run it without Defined Networking?

Yes, entirely. Defined Networking sells the control plane conveniences, not the network itself.

Trivy: What can Trivy scan?

Container images, filesystems, Git repositories, Kubernetes clusters and infrastructure-as-code, for vulnerabilities, misconfigurations, secrets and licences.

Nebula: How do I revoke a host?

Add its certificate fingerprint to the blocklist in the configuration of the other hosts and reload them. There is no online revocation check.

Trivy: Does Trivy need a server?

No. It is a single binary, which is a large part of why it became a default in CI.

Nebula: Is it a good fit for laptops?

Less so than the identity provider based tools. There is no single sign on, so every laptop needs a certificate issued and renewed by whatever process you build.
